It get's MUCH BETTER when you can tie it all back. That happens for most people at around 9 inches or so. If you're at 5 now, then you have 4 to go. Or about 8 months. You may find, however, that you will be able to tie a half tail sooner than that. This will control the hair around your face, which is the most problematic anyway. You may just be able to do that now, give it a try!

What is a half tail, and how does it work?
Re: Whats the toughest awkward stage length?
Posted by Reflective on January 16, 2004 at 00:32:46: Previous Next
In Reply to: Re: Whats the toughest awkward stage length? posted by Cola on January 15, 2004 at 09:18:28:
Take the hair from the top half of your head only and pull it back into a tail. Leave the hair that is lower than the tops of your ears down.

I think by 6" one feels like throwing their hands up in the air in frustration. That was about the worst for me. But to cut it at that point would be a great mistake for in about 3/4 of a year you will be able to get very much into a tail. Hairs that at that point are not quite long enough can always be pinned (barely noticable) until they finally fit into the Tail. Hold on...........I doubt you will regret it.

When I was at the same stage as you about a month and a half ago I took the plunge and gave myself an undercut! I know many people here are against them and I wont tell you to do one as ultimatly its your choice and you have to be happy with it.
I used clippers and undercut my hair to a number 5. Admittedly it looks a bit strange on the back where the hairline goes lower than the sides and hence there is a short bit sticking out from the lower hair (but that is pretty much unnoticable now and I dont have to look at the back of my head). However the top hair which is left long now hangs much tidier and straighter and I am much happier with the fact that I use a lot less gel and It seems to do something closer to what I want it to do.
I am now regrowing the back and sides as by april they should be about 3 - 3 1/2 inches which will mesh nicely with the hair on the top which will be about 7 - 8 inches by then.
My hair is very very thick and has slight waves in, which seem to be decreasing with weight. so for the most part I am happy with my decision, though I do miss the longer hair on the back as that used to meet my shirt collar and kept me warm... but then it was either have that and struggle for a few months or make things easier when I was considering cutting it all.
